"Bye Bye Embryo ... Hello Fetus!"



Hey Baby! Where U At?

Congratulations! You're a fetus now! This means your essential structures are in place and need further growth and development so you can get born. You can respond to touch and your hand would close if someone could touch your palm.

*Note: This calendar is based on the LMP (Last Menstrual Period) system of measuring the length of pregnancy as 40 weeks (±2 weeks) from the first day of the mother's last menstrual period. Subtract two weeks to get the fetus' approximate age in weeks.
